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1/2 cup chopped onion
- 1 can cream of mushroom soup
- 1 cup beef broth
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 cup cooked egg noodles (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Brown ground beef with onion in a skillet until fully cooked.
- Drain excess fat and stir in cream of mushroom soup, beef broth,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per.
- Transfer mixture to a greased baking dish and top with cooked egg noodles if desired.
- Bake for 30 minutes until bubbly and golden.
Notes
- For a lighter version
- use low‑fat ground beef and low‑sodium broth. Add a handful of shredded cheese during the last 10 minutes for extra richness.
